Como qualquer plataforma baseada em código, há momentos em que os desenvolvedores precisam depurar seu código para testar a funcionalidade de um Bric personalizado. Blocs e sua API é projetada com o objetivo de tornar o processo de depuração de código de terceiros o mais simplificado e eficiente possível.
O console de depuração.
Blocs tem um console de desenvolvedor integrado que facilita o registro e a depuração de problemas que um desenvolvedor pode encontrar ao criar um Bric personalizado para Blocs. O console do desenvolvedor pode ser acessado através do menu principal Desenvolvedor> Console do desenvolvedor. Para postar um registro de depuração no console, use o depurar chamada de API.
Modo de desenvolvedor.
Blocs vem com um modo de desenvolvedor embutido que pode ser ativado através do principal Blocs preferências (menu principal Blocs > Preferências). Habilitar esta opção impedirá o cache de tempo de execução, o que significa que quaisquer alterações feitas nas funções javascript em um Bric personalizado (enquanto o Blocs aplicativo em execução), serão carregados no ambiente de design em tempo real. Isso ajuda a depurar e experimentar um padrão Brics funcionalidade sem a necessidade de reiniciar o Blocs aplicação.
Reiniciar o Bric State.
Blocs tem um recurso integrado que permite que os desenvolvedores redefinam rapidamente vários aspectos de um Bric personalizado. É possível redefinir completamente um Bric de volta ao seu estado inicial (adicionar à página) ou, alternativamente, redefinir apenas aspectos individuais de um Bric personalizado, como HTML, recursos ou valores de modelo. Essas opções são úteis se um desenvolvedor fizer alterações no conteúdo de um Bric, pois ele liberará os dados antigos de um Bric que estão armazenados em um projeto e os substituirá pela versão mais recente do Brics dados padrão.
Essas opções de redefinição podem ser acessadas por clique direito qualquer Bric personalizado e selecionando Redefinir Bric personalizado do costume Brics menu contextual.